Name of Work: MMGSUY/23-24 Maraura/02
Sl. No. Item Description
1Satjora BazarPrithivipur Mandir Tak
2Clearing and Grubbing :- Clearing and Grubbing Road Land (By manual means)including uprooting wild vegetation, grass, bushes, shrubs, saplings and trees ofgirth upto 300mm, removals of stumps of such trees cut earlier & disposal of unserviceable materials & stacking of serviceable materials to be used or auctioned upto a lead of 1000 m including removal and disposal of top organic soil not exeeding 150mm in thickness as per technical specification clause 201.1 and direction of E/I
3Scarifying :- Scarifying the existing bituminous road surface to a depth of 150 mm and disposal of scarified material with a lift upto 3 m and lead upto 1000 m as per Technical Specification Clause 301.4.
4Construction of Subgrade And Earthen Shoulders :- Construction of subgrade and earthen shoulders with approved material obtained from borrow pits with all lifts and leads, transporting to site, spreading, grading to required slope and compacted to meet requirement of Table 300.2 with lead upto 1000 m as per Technical Specification Clause 303.1.
5Granular Sub-base with Well Graded Material(Grade 2) :- Construction of granular sub-base by providing well graded material, spreading in uniform layers with motor grader on prepared surface, mixing by mix in place method with rotavatorat OMC, and compacting with smoothwheelroller to achieve thedesired density, complete as per Technical Specification Clause 401.
6Water Bound Macadam Gr III :- Providing, laying, spreading and compacting stone aggregates of specific sizes to water bound macadam specification including spreading in uniform thickness, hand packing, rolling with smoothwheel roller 80-100 kN in stages to proper grade and camber, applying and brooming, stone screening to fill-up the interstices of coarse aggregate, watering and compacting to the required density Grading 3 as per Technical Specification Clause 405.
7Prime Coat :- Providing and applying primer coat with Bitumen emulsion (SS-1)on prepared surface of granular base including cleaning of road surface and spraying primer at the rate of 0.70- 1.0 kg/sqm using mechanical means as per Technical Specification Clause 502.
8Tack Coat :- Providing and applying tack coat with bitumen emulsion using emulsion pressure distributor at the rate of 0.25 to 0.30 kg per sqm on the prepared granular surface tretaed with Primer and clened with hydriloc broom as per technical specification aclouse 503.
9Tack Coat :- Providing and applying tack coat with Bitumen emulsion (RS-1) using emulsion distributor at the rate of 0.20 to 0.25kg per sqm on the prepared bituminous surface cleaned with Hydraulic broom as per Technical Specification Clause 503.
10Bituminous Macadam :- Providing and laying bituminous macadam with 100-120 TPH hot mix plant producing an average output of 75 tonnes per hour using crushed aggregates of specified grading premixed with bituminous binder, transported to site, laid over apreviously prepared surface with paver finisher to the required grade, level and alignment and rolled as per clauses 501.6 and 501.7 to achieve the desired compaction.
11Semi Dense Bituminous Concrete :- Providing and laying semi dense bituminous concrete with 100-120 TPH batch type HMP producing an average output of 75 tonnes per hour using crushed aggregates of specified grading, premixed with bituminous binder @ 4.5 to 5 per cent of mix and filler, transporting the hot mix to work site, laying with a hydrostatic paver finisher with sensor control to the required grade, level and alignment, rolling with smooth wheeled, vibratory and tandem rollers to achieve the desired compaction as per MoRTH specification clause No. 508 complete in all respects.
12Dry Lean Cement Concrete :- Construction of dry lean cement concrete Sub-base over a prepared sub-grade with coarse and find aggregates conforming to IS:383, the size of coarse aggregate not exceeding 25mm, aggregate cement ratio not to exceed 15:1 aggregate gradation after blending to be as per table 600-1 cement content not to be less than 150kg/cum optimum moisture content to be determined during trial length construction, concrete strength not be less than 10 Mpa at 7 days, mixed in a batching plant, transported to site, laid with a paver with electronic sensor, compacting with 8-10 tonnes vibratory roller, finishing and curing.
13Panel Concrete Pavement :- Construction of Panel concrete ,plain cement concrete pavement, thickness as per design, over a prepared sub base, with 43 grade cement or any other type as per Caluse 1501.2.2 M 30(Grade) coarse and fine aggregates conforming to IS:383, maximum size of coarse aggregate not exceeding25mm, mixed in a concrete mixer ofnot less than 0.2 cum capasity and appropriate weigh batcher using approved mix design ,laid in approved fixed side formwork (steel channel,laying and fixing of 125 micron thick polythene film,wedges, steel plates including levelling the formwork as per drawing), spreading the concrete with shovels, rakes, compacted using needle, screed and plate vibrators and finished in continous operation including provision of contraction and expansion ,construction joints, applying debonding strips ,primer ,sealant ,dowel bars, near approaches tobridge/ culvert and construction joints, admixture as approved ,curing of concrete slabs for 14 days. Curing compound (where specified) and water finishing to lines andgrade as per drawing and Technical specification Clause 1501. PCC Grade M-30 EachPanel (0.50X0.50) thickness 125 mm
